What Are Some Fun Activities for Senior Citizens? Visit a Museum

A museum date offers quiet stimulation without the noise or rush that can drain energy. Some of the top museums in the Carroll area include:

  • Carroll County Historical Museum
  • Farmstead Museum at Swan Lake 
  • Museum of Danish America
  • Milwaukee Depot
  • Forest Park Museum and Arboretum
  • Dow House Historic Site

Museum visits work especially well for budget-friendly date nights because they invite discussion without pressure. A single artifact, photograph, or newspaper clipping can lead to reflections on childhood, careers, family traditions, or how the town has changed over the years. Many seniors find that shared curiosity strengthens emotional connection, even when very little is said out loud. The setting naturally supports calm conversation and moments of comfortable silence.

Cost is rarely a barrier with small local museums, making this an ideal low-budget option that still feels thoughtful.

What Do Older People Do on Dates? Arts and Crafts

Creating something together shifts the focus away from conversation alone and gives hands and minds a shared purpose.

  • Painting
  • Coloring
  • Assembling a small keepsake
  • Working with fabric

Allows couples to enjoy quiet companionship while still feeling engaged.

These dates work well because there is no right or wrong outcome. The process matters more than the final result, which helps remove self-consciousness.

Seniors often find that crafting opens the door to relaxed conversation, laughter, and storytelling as memories surface naturally. Sitting side by side, working at a comfortable pace, creates a sense of teamwork that strengthens emotional closeness.

Arts and crafts also fit easily into a low-budget routine. Many projects use materials already on hand or inexpensive supplies from local stores. Finished pieces can be gifted to family or saved as reminders of shared time.

Carroll Companionship Tips: Head Outdoors

Spending time outdoors offers an easy way to reset the mood and reconnect without planning an entire outing. Quiet parks and shaded seating areas create comfortable spaces where seniors can enjoy fresh air without crowds. Stepping outside together, even briefly, changes the rhythm of the day and often leads to more relaxed conversation. The slower pace makes it easier to notice small details, from shifting light to familiar scenery.

Outdoor dates work best when expectations stay low. Sitting on a bench, taking a short walk, or simply watching the world pass by allows couples to share space without pressure. Many seniors find that being outdoors encourages reflection and storytelling, especially when surroundings feel familiar. Silence feels comfortable rather than awkward, which can be just as meaningful as conversation.

Watch A Movie

Choosing a classic film or a story tied to a shared memory turns viewing into low-cost bonding rather than background noise. The familiar setting makes it easy to relax and enjoy the moment without distractions.

Movie dates work well because they allow connection at any energy level. Couples can pause to comment, laugh, or reminisce, or simply sit together in comfortable silence. Many seniors find that films from earlier decades spark memories of first dates, family milestones, or simpler times. Those moments often lead to gentle conversation that feels natural rather than forced.

Keeping it low-cost is easy. Streaming services or even local television programming provide plenty of options. Adding popcorn or a warm blanket helps signal that the evening is special without adding expense.

What Is the 7-7-7 Rule for Couples?

The 7-7-7 rule for couples is a simple relationship rhythm designed to keep the connection strong without feeling overwhelming. The idea is to schedule a date every seven days, plan an overnight or special outing every seven weeks, and take a longer getaway or meaningful shared experience every seven months.

For seniors, this structure works best to keep up meaningful time together when it stays flexible, focusing less on travel and more on intention, such as a weekly coffee date, a quieter change of scenery every couple of months, and a meaningful tradition that marks the year together.
